Close to Princeton's Palmer Square, historic parks, and popular public and private schools, this delightful "tree house" is the perfect combination of stylish architecture and glorious setting. Featured in House Beautiful's Building Manual, Summer 1982, this Short and Ford Architects designed home combines energy efficiency with compact, practical design. Southwest facing, this hillside contemporary features walls of cascading windows which capture the warmth of the winter sun and provide panoramic views of the lush woodlands. Owner and guest needs are allocated to different living levels. A welcoming foyer opens to the living and dining areas with fireplace, cathedral ceilings, and clerestory windows, a sun-lit master bedroom and bath, a greenhouse room, and a cheerful lemon kitchen. On the lower level is generous space for guests and family activities including two additional bedrooms, full bath, family room and office with sliding glass doors to the sprawling wood decks and natural landscape beyond.
